Marseille Game off after Angry Fans March to Training Ground

Saturday, 30 January, 2021 - 19:00 A banner attacks the president of Olympique de Marseille, Jacques-Henry Eyraud, in the city center, Saturday, January 30. (AFP) Asharq Al-Awsat The French league postponed Marseille s home game against Rennes just three hours before kickoff on Saturday after angry Marseille fans marched to the club s training complex to protest poor results. The LFP added in a statement that no new date has been set for the match. But seventh-place Marseille s next home game will fall under close scrutiny since it is against bitter rival Paris Saint-Germain next weekend. A video posted by local newspaper La Provence earlier Saturday showed a tree burning outside the entrance to La Commanderie, amid reports that fans were throwing flares and trying to force their way in.

Angry Olympique supporters attack training ground

Angry Olympique Marseille supporters attack training ground On Kindly Share This Story: Hundreds of angry Olympique Marseille supporters protested at the club’s Commanderie training centre on Saturday, briefly breaking into the facility. The fans, who were demonstrating against the club leadership and the team’s poor run of results, assembled in the afternoon in front of the Commanderie and threw smoke bombs and firecrackers. “300 OM supporters violently attacked police officers present to secure La Commanderie,” the local police at Bouches-du-Rhone tweeted, adding that it immediately sent reinforcements “to put an end to the damage” and saying they had made 25 arrests.

Marseille match postponed after fans attack training ground

Marseille match postponed after fans attack training ground Marseille (AFP) – Marseille’s game against Rennes in France’s Ligue 1 on Saturday was postponed after hundreds of angry supporters broke into the club’s training ground in a violent protest. “Given the incidents this afternoon at the Olympique de Marseille training ground, the game between OM and Rennes is postponed to a later date,” the French league (LFP) said in a statement posted on its website. The fans, who were demonstrating against the club leadership and the team’s poor recent run of results, assembled in the afternoon in front of Marseille’s La Commanderie training ground, throwing smoke bombs and firecrackers.
